Technical Considerations for Crafters
Before you rush to print or cut, there are technical nuances to consider. Even the best design assets require proper handling.
Line Weight and Detail: Check the thinness of the font strokes. If you plan to use this for sticker design on very small items (under 2 inches), ensure the lines are thick enough to hold together during weeding. For larger formats like tumbler wrap or wall art, the detail will shine.
Color Contrast: Since this is a vector, you can change colors instantly. Test it against both light and dark backgrounds. On a dark product, a white or metallic gold render will pop, while on a light product, a deep navy or crimson might be needed for visibility.
Resolution for Sublimation: Always convert your SVG to a high-resolution PNG (at least 300 DPI) before sending it to your sublimation printer. This prevents blurry edges on fabric transfers.
Design Pairings and Styling
To elevate this illustration, consider pairing it with complementary fonts if you are adding extra text. A classic serif font can reinforce the historical theme, while a modern sans serif font keeps it contemporary. For a softer touch, a delicate script font could work for phrases like "Handmade with Love" underneath the main quote.
Avoid overcrowding the composition. Let the typography breathe. If you are creating a design bundle, pair this with simple geometric shapes like stars or banners rather than busy patterns. This maintains the premium aesthetic that attracts higher-paying customers.
